Laminate vs Hybrid vs Vinyl: Scratch and Stain Test

Flooring specialist cleaning and inspecting stain test results on hybrid and laminate flooring samples in Cleveland, Queensland.

We get asked the same question almost every day: which is better, hybrid, laminate or vinyl? I’ve had that conversation hundreds of times, and the honest answer has always been “it depends on your circumstances.” True, and completely useless if you’re standing in front of three samples trying to decide.

So rather than tell you again, I decided to show you. Seven floors on the bench (two vinyls, three hybrids and two laminates), attacked with a screwdriver, then left under red wine and cold coffee for five days.

Laminate was the most scratch-resistant flooring of the three, and it wasn’t close. It was the only material that came away with no visible scratching and no debris, and the cheapest board on the bench beat a hybrid costing more than twice as much. Within the hybrid and vinyl group, wear layer thickness predicted the result almost perfectly. The screwdriver punched clean through one sample, a 0.3 mm vinyl plank. Notably, the hybrid with the same 0.3 mm wear layer wasn’t breached.

Everything cleaned up reasonably well after five days of wine and coffee, but not equally. That’s the part I got wrong on camera and only worked out afterwards.

Below: the full results with scores, prices and wear layer data for all seven samples, the limitations of how I tested, and why AC ratings and Class ratings didn’t predict any of this.

What We Tested

Seven samples, all products we actually sell. Prices are per square metre at the time of writing.

Product Type Board Wear Layer Manufacturer Rating Price/m²
Entry-level vinyl plank Vinyl plank 2 mm 0.3 mm PVC/PU Class 23 domestic / 31 commercial ~$25
Eclipse Nature’s Best Vinyl plank 4.5 mm 0.5 mm PVC/PU Class 23 domestic / 32 commercial $42.95
Eclipse Classique Hybrid 5.5 mm 0.5 mm PVC/PU Class 23 domestic / 32 commercial $29.95
Eclipse Nebula Hybrid 8 mm 0.3 mm PVC/PU Class 23 domestic / 31 commercial Discontinued
Eclipse Stone-Tek Hybrid 9.7 mm 0.7 mm PVC/PU Class 34 commercial / 42 industrial $63.95
Eclipse Aqua Heim Laminate n/a Melamine AC4 $24.95
Sunstar Adare Laminate n/a Melamine AC4 ~$36

One sample isn’t named. The specification is what matters here, not the badge.

The Nebula is the odd one out, and it’s the reason I included it. It’s an 8 mm hybrid with only a 0.3 mm wear layer, the same wear layer as the 2 mm vinyl plank sitting next to it. It’s discontinued now, but it gave me a clean comparison: identical surface, completely different core. Same story with the two 0.5 mm samples, one vinyl and one hybrid.

That’s the pairing that makes this test worth doing. If the wear layer is the same, anything that differs is down to what’s underneath it.

How We Tested It

I want to be upfront about the method, because it wasn’t a laboratory and I’m not going to pretend it was.

The scratch test. Same screwdriver, same tip, same person, roughly the same pressure across every board, except for the laminate, which was treated much more harshly. Assessment was purely visual: no depth gauge, no magnification, no before-and-after measurements. I looked at whether the tip broke through the wear layer and whether the sample produced debris.

The stain test. Equal amounts of red wine and cold black coffee on every sample, left to sit for five days. Cleaned with the same sponge (green scourer on one side) and plain water. No cleaning products.

The Limitations, Stated Plainly

Four things about this test are imperfect, and you should know all of them before you weigh the results:

  • The board colours weren’t matched. This is the big one. Scratches show up more on dark boards; the wine residue showed up more on light ones. That cuts in both directions across the sample set, and it means the visual comparison isn’t perfectly like-for-like.
  • The laminates got a harder time than everything else. I spent longer working on them with the screwdriver because I couldn’t get them to mark. That’s a flaw in the method, but note which way it cuts. Laminate got the roughest treatment and still came out cleanest.
  • It’s a gouge, not wear. A screwdriver tip is a concentrated point load. It’s a fair simulation of a dropped knife, a dog’s claw, a bit of grit under a chair leg or a stone in a boot tread. It isn’t a simulation of ten years of foot traffic.
  • No instrumentation. Visual assessment only, no photographic before-and-after.

I said a couple of times while filming that the test was “probably a bit unfair.” Thinking about it since, I’d put it differently: it was harsh, and harsher on the laminate than on anything else. That’s the opposite of unfair to the products that lost.

Result 1: The Scratch Test

Product Wear Layer Through the Wear Layer? Debris Score
Entry-level vinyl plank 0.3 mm Yes Yes 2/5
Eclipse Nebula Hybrid 0.3 mm No Yes 2/5
Eclipse Nature’s Best Vinyl 0.5 mm No Yes 3/5
Eclipse Classique Hybrid 0.5 mm No Yes 3/5
Eclipse Stone-Tek Hybrid 0.7 mm No Yes 4/5
Eclipse Aqua Heim Laminate Melamine No None 5/5
Sunstar Adare Laminate Melamine No None 5/5

The 0.3 mm vinyl was the only sample the screwdriver punched through. It went straight past the wear layer, through the print film and into the layers underneath. I wasn’t expecting that, and it’s the single clearest argument I can give you against buying a floor on price alone.

Every hybrid and vinyl sample produced debris. Little white chunks of wear layer coming off the board as I dragged the tip across it. Once you wipe them away and stand back, most of the damage is hard to see from standing height, but get down close and the indentations are still there. On the 0.7 mm Stone-Tek you can still find the scratch line after a good rub. It hasn’t gone anywhere; it’s just less obvious.

Neither laminate produced any debris at all. The only thing coming off was metal residue from the screwdriver tip itself: grey marks that wiped straight off with a finger and left nothing behind. On the entry-level Aqua Heim there’s one tiny mark if you hunt for it. On the Sunstar, nothing.

Wear Layer Thickness Matters, But the Core Matters Too

Read down that table and the pattern is obvious: within the vinyl and hybrid group, thicker wear layer means better scratch resistance. 0.3 mm is genuinely thin. 0.7 mm is a real improvement.

But look at the two 0.3 mm samples. The vinyl was breached; the hybrid wasn’t. Identical wear layer, different outcome. The reason is what’s underneath. The vinyl is soft, so the tip sinks in and keeps going, and the wear layer stretches and tears with it. The hybrid has a rigid core that stops the tip from going deep, so the wear layer is supported and only abrades rather than punctures.

So: the wear layer determines what marks it, and the core determines how badly.

Result 2: The Stain Test, and Where I Got It Wrong on Camera

I filmed the cleanup after five days and my conclusion at the time was that everything came up well and the differences were minor. Watching for wine residue, I said a couple of times that I could see a faint reddish tone on the vinyl and hybrid, but I put it down to a dirty sponge and moved on.

It wasn’t the sponge. Once the samples were completely dry and I looked again properly, that faint red tone on the lighter vinyl and hybrid boards was still there. It’s permanent. It hasn’t come out since.

Here’s why, and it’s the same material science that drives the scratch result: the PVC/polyurethane wear layer on hybrid and vinyl is porous. Given five days, the wine pigment worked its way in, and once it’s in, it doesn’t come back out. No amount of scrubbing shifts it.

The melamine wear layer on the laminates isn’t porous in the same way. The wine sat on top of it for five days and then washed off, leaving nothing.

To be fair to the resilient floors: this is a five-day dwell time. Nobody sensible leaves a spill for five days. Wipe up wine within a few hours, and you won’t see any of this. The coffee behaved itself on everything. And a fair bit of the scrubbing effort on every sample was getting residue out of the embossing texture rather than off the surface itself. Deeper embossing traps more, regardless of material.

But if you have kids, or you rent the place out, or you’re just realistic about how long things sit on a floor before anyone deals with them, that porosity is worth knowing about.

Stain scores: laminate 5/5, hybrid 4/5, vinyl 4/5.

Why the Spec Sheets Didn’t Predict Any of This

Here’s the part that I think matters most, because it explains something that looks bizarre in the results table.

The Eclipse Stone-Tek hybrid is rated Class 34 commercial / Class 42 industrial. That is a serious rating. It’s approved for industrial use. It costs $63.95 per square metre. It scratched.

The Eclipse Aqua Heim laminate is AC4. It costs $24.95 per square metre. It didn’t.

That looks like a contradiction, and it isn’t. The two numbers measure different things and are produced by different tests.

  • AC ratings (AC1 to AC5) come from EN 13329. It’s a Taber abrasion test: an abrasive wheel is spun against the surface, and they count revolutions until the print layer starts to wear through. AC4 means it survived at least 4,000 cycles. It’s a measure of abrasion: grit, sand and foot traffic gradually wearing the surface away.
  • Class ratings (23, 31, 32, 34, 42) come from EN ISO 10874. This is a use classification, not a hardness score. It tells you the intensity of traffic a product is built for across a bundle of criteria. The first digit is the setting: 2 is domestic, 3 is commercial, 4 is industrial. The second is the intensity within it.

Neither one is a scratch test. Abrasion is a wheel sanding a surface. Scratching is a hard point gouging into it. A floor can be excellent at one and mediocre at the other, and that’s precisely what we saw on the bench.

This is also why comparing a vinyl’s wear layer in millimetres against a laminate’s AC rating is meaningless. Different specifications, different protocols, different physical properties. There’s no conversion between them, and anyone who offers you one is guessing.

That gap is the whole reason this test was worth doing. The spec sheet answers “how long before it wears out.” It doesn’t answer “what happens when the dog runs across it.”

So What’s Actually Going On in the Material?

Laminate’s wear layer is melamine, a hard thermoset resin, essentially a sheet of cured plastic glass over the print layer. Very hard, very difficult to scratch, non-porous.

Hybrid and vinyl use a PVC/polyurethane wear layer. Softer, flexible, more forgiving underfoot, and easier to gouge, with more pigment absorption.

There’s a trade-off attached, and it’s not in laminate’s favour. That hard surface has to sit on something rigid, or it’ll crack, which is why laminate boards feel harder underfoot and are noticeably noisier in the room than hybrid or vinyl. Hardness and quietness are pulling in opposite directions here. You don’t get both.

What We’d Actually Recommend

Based on this test plus what we see coming back from customers:

Kids and Pets

Choose laminate. Claws, toys, dropped cutlery and dragged furniture. This is the scenario the scratch test simulates most directly, and laminate won it outright.

Wet Areas and Moisture Risk

Choose hybrid or vinyl. This test did not test water, and I’m not going to imply otherwise. Hybrid and vinyl have the edge on moisture, and it’s a real edge. Note that our Eclipse Aqua laminates are water-resistant, which narrows the gap, but if moisture is your primary concern, that’s still resilient flooring territory.

High Traffic Areas

Choose laminate. Same reasoning as above: grit tracked in on shoes is the everyday version of the screwdriver test.

Noise-Sensitive Rooms

It depends which noise. There are two different problems here, and they have different answers.

For airborne noise (the hollow tapping you hear in the room you’re standing in), vinyl is quietest, and laminate is the loudest of the three.

For structure-borne noise travelling down to the room below, laminate is actually more forgiving than vinyl because of the underlay it sits on. So an upstairs bedroom and a downstairs living room want different things, and it’s worth being clear about which one is bothering you before you choose.

Large Commercial Floors

Usually glue-down vinyl. You’ll see vinyl plank in every Woolworths and Coles you walk into, and it’s not a cost decision. Under that volume of foot traffic, you don’t want a floating floor moving around; you want it stuck down.

The trade-off is on the way out. Lifting a glue-down floor means pulling up the planks and grinding the adhesive residue off the slab. A floating floor you just unclip and start again. Domestically, that’s a strong argument for floating floors.

Would I Do It Differently Next Time?

Yes, and I’m happy to. If there’s interest, part two would be a controlled version:

  • Matched board colours across all samples, so the visual comparison is genuinely like-for-like.
  • Fixed passes at a measured load, rather than me leaning on a screwdriver.
  • Photographed before-and-after for every sample under the same lighting.
  • Staged dwell times of one hour, one day and five days, because the one-hour number is the one that actually reflects real life.
  • A castor chair and dropped-object test, which is much closer to how floors get damaged in practice than anything I did here.

The Bottom Line

Across seven floors, one screwdriver and five days of coffee and red wine:

  • Laminate is the most scratch-resistant of the three, by a clear margin. It’s the only material that came away with no visible damage and no debris, and the only one that shed wine completely.
  • Hybrid sits in the middle, and its rigid core does real work. At the same wear layer thickness, hybrid resisted deep gouging better than vinyl every time.
  • Vinyl is the softest and marked most easily, and a 0.3 mm wear layer is genuinely thin. Ours failed the test.

And the part I’d underline: price didn’t predict performance. The $24.95 laminate beat the $63.95 industrial-rated hybrid on scratch resistance. Not because the hybrid is a bad floor. It isn’t, and its rating is legitimate for what that rating measures. It’s because you were never comparing like with like in the first place.

None of which means laminate is the right answer for your house. It means scratch resistance is one axis, moisture is another, noise is a third, and the honest recommendation still depends on which room you’re standing in. But at least now the scratch question has an answer you can see rather than one you have to take my word for.
